**Vendor note: Inkmill markdown pipeline**

Rendering for Parchway docs is outsourced to Inkmill under an annual contract, renewing each March. They handle sanitization and PDF export; we own the upload queue. SLA: 4-hour response on rendering failures. Escalate only after two failed retries. Their support desk is reachable at the address below.

billing contact of hahaf-baguf = zorael.tammir.jorius@sivrelhq.internal

Welcome to the Bramblejay platform team. One of your first tasks involves the Hollowpike message broker upgrade: we move brokers one node at a time, draining partitions and confirming consumer lag returns to baseline before proceeding. Never upgrade more than one node per hour, and record each step in the migration log. To run the drain tooling against the broker admin service, authenticate with the key below.

service key, bawip-kawip: zpat4_kOcB

Release artifacts are built in the sealed CI runner, signed, and pushed to the internal registry. No manual signing. Flag-state snapshots are signed separately and verified at agent startup; tampered snapshots halt rollout and page on-call. Rotation cadence: 90 days, tracked in the Larkspur register. Reviewer checklist: confirm provenance attestation, confirm signer identity matches registry policy, confirm no key reuse across environments. The active verification key is as follows.

rollout seal: bky4_x7Gc

Q: Where's the evacuation-chair store, and can night shift get in?

A: Yep — it's the grey cupboard by the stairwell on level 4, next to the fire panel. It's locked so the chairs don't wander off, but anyone on shift can open it. Just punch in the code below.

door code, kawip-bagap: bdg-HQEWH-4

**Runbook: Flaky integration tests — Paygrove service**

The checkout integration suite intermittently fails when the mock ledger responds slower than the client timeout. Before rerunning, confirm the sandbox ledger container is warm and clear any stale idempotency keys from the fixture store. Most flakes trace back to timeout and retry settings diverging between CI and local runs. The CI environment uses the following configuration:

config for kafof-bawef:
holath:
  log_level: debug
  metrics_host: metrics.holath.qorvelsys.internal
  pin: 2191
  pool_size: 32